The Pope says Child abuse in Ireland was a heinous crime - but more resignations from Irish Bishops, including Bishop of Galway Martin Drennan, are not expected.

In the last hour The Pontiff has commented following 2 days of meetings between Bishops.

The talks between 24 Irish Bishops and Pope Benedict in the Vatican were described as "frank and open".

However in a decision that could anger Victims groups there was no mention of financial compensation, no talk of the Pope meeting abuse victims, and it seems no further resignations of Bishops mentioned in the Ryan and Murphy reports are expected.
